Solution for Integrating CJ188 Energy Data Acquisition Gateway with a Modbus Energy Management Platform

A large manufacturing plant is facing increasing energy costs. The facility has installed a large number of smart water meters using the CJ188 protocol, covering everything from production lines and cooling towers to cafeteria water usage. Due to the large quantity and dispersed locations of these meters, manual meter reading is not only inefficient and causes significant data delays, but also fails to detect pipe leaks or abnormal water usage in real time, creating major challenges for energy management. Therefore, the plant needs a solution that can centrally collect scattered, high-volume water usage data into an information-based energy supervision platform, enabling a shift from "rough statistical" to "real-time lean" management.

 

Solution

To address these pain points, WideIOT deploys energy data acquisition gateways to provide a lightweight data collection solution. The gateway features multiple RS485/RS232 ports, allowing it to collect data from multiple CJ188 water meters simultaneously. The CJ188 protocol data is uniformly converted into the standard Modbus protocol and then connected via 4G to the plant's energy management platform. This enables functions such as water usage monitoring, alerting, management, statistical reporting, and analysis, helping the plant improve its energy management capabilities and energy efficiency.

Key Features

1. Real-Time Monitoring and Visualization – Managers can view real-time and cumulative water usage across all workshops, key equipment, and scenarios on an energy dashboard, effectively replacing manual meter reading and manual statistics, and establishing a digital management model.

 

2. Abnormal Alerts and Localization – By configuring edge alert rules on the gateway, when abnormal parameters are detected, the system immediately sends alerts via SMS, WeChat, or email, helping maintenance staff quickly locate leaks and stop losses in a timely manner.

 

3. Refined Management and Performance Assessment – Generates daily, weekly, and monthly water usage reports, and calculates water consumption per unit of product, enabling independent cost accounting and guiding science-based water conservation efforts to effectively drive water and cost savings.

 

4. Multi-Protocol Data Integration – In addition to water meters, the gateway can also connect to electricity, gas, and heat meters, achieving comprehensive management of water, electricity, gas, and heat, as well as correlation analysis, providing comprehensive data support for process optimization.
